Antarpply Expeditions

Antarpply Expeditions is a leading operator of small ship expedition cruises to Antarctica and the sub-Antarctic islands. Based in Ushuaia, we specialise in taking small groups and individual passengers to some of the most spectacular, remote and pristine parts of the world on board the MV USHUAIA. At a maximum of just 90 passengers, the ship is one of the smallest ships operating in Antarctica and being under 100 passengers means everyone can get off the ship at the same time without the need for groups.

Destinations:

Antarctica, South Georgia, Falklands

Expedition Style:

Adventurous, Typically 51 - 100 passengers, Local Specialist

Aranui Cruises

The Aranui 5, a mixed passenger-freighter ship, is an exceptional way to explore the French Polynesia’s mystical islands of the Marquesas, located 1500 km from Tahiti. For the past 40 years, passengers sailing with the Aranui have access to villages that no other boat serves. In addition to this traditional itinerary, the ship offers exceptional cruises to every island group in French Polynesia including the Austral, Society and Tuamotu Islands, as well as neighbouring Pitcairn Islands, taking passengers to some of the most remote and rarely visited places in the world.

Destinations:

South Pacific Islands

Expedition Style:

Adventurous

Bark Europa

Since 2000, Bark EUROPA has been crossing the world’s oceans, offering hands-on sailing experiences to adventure seekers. Known as the "Ocean Wanderer," EUROPA follows traditional sailing routes, exploring remote islands, icy polar regions, and vast oceans. Guests, also known as voyage crew, actively participate in sailing the ship, by setting sails, steering, and lookout duty, creating a unique and immersive experience.

Destinations:

Antarctica, Central America, South America, Chilean Fjords, South Pacific Islands, Europe, North America

Expedition Style:

Adventurous, Typically under 50 passengers, Typically 51 - 100 passengers

Quixote Expeditions

For travelers who want to experience Antarctica without the typical cruise ship environment, Quixote Expeditions offers a truly unique option. Catering to just 12 guests, our micro-cruises provide an exclusive, flexible, and immersive experience focused on maximizing time onshore. The fly-in, fly-out option across the Drake Passage eliminates the long sea journey, giving guests more time to explore and photograph Antarctica’s extraordinary landscapes and wildlife. With our vessels Hans Hansson and Ocean Tramp, we adapt each itinerary based on daily conditions and sightings, ensuring a personalized journey for those who seek a deeper, more independent adventure in Antarctica.

Destinations:

Antarctica, Falklands, South Georgia, Chilean Fjords, South America

Expedition Style:

Adventurous, Typically under 50 passengers, Local Specialist

Selar

Selar’s debut polar expeditions are set to be something truly different. Unlike other ships that host up to 200 passengers, Selar will welcome 36 passengers onboard a bespoke, 230 feet, close-to-zero-emission sailing ship, allowing for the best experiences. Each expedition will be led by a handpicked crew of skilled polar navigators and explorers, granting exceptional access to onshore off track experiences - from observing polar bears in complete silence and hiking on the ice edge above 80°, to enjoying a hot chocolate in a driftwood hut and kayaking in front of a deep blue glacier surrounded by the sound of ice.

Destinations:

Arctic, Svalbard, Greenland, Norway

Expedition Style:

Luxury, Typically under 50 passengers
